## Ownership

The intermittent DNS resolution failures in the Fenwick staging cluster are tracked under this module. Root cause is suspected caching behavior in the Norrell resolver sidecar; mitigation is a forced TTL floor. Security-relevant changes to resolver config require review before merge. The current owner and point of contact for escalations is listed below.

account owner for bawip-tahag: Raleth Quenok

FINANCE REVIEW SUMMARY — Sales Leads

Quick recap on the Vexalune launch numbers. Margins on the starter bundle are tighter than we'd like, but volume projections from the Oakmere pilot make up for it. Promo budget is approved through end of quarter, and Teo's forecast shows breakeven by month four if conversion holds above plan. We'll revisit discounting authority at the next sync. For now, keep pushing the bundle. Before you brief your teams, please read the note below and keep it to this group.

board note of tahog-yaguf: Belaelox Foods is in early talks to buy Eliathix Holdings for about $24.8 million. The Tamion launch date is November 1, and nothing goes to the press before then.

## Deploying the Gatewick Proctor Queue

Deploys are pretty painless: push to main, wait for the pipeline, then watch the queue drain dashboard for five minutes. If candidates pile up mid-exam, roll back first and ask questions later — the queue replays safely. Everything the workers care about lives in one config block, shown here for reference.

settings of bafof-yagef:
JOROX_PIN=8740
JOROX_TENANT=pelox
JOROX_METRICS_HOST=metrics.jorox.qorvelworks.internal
JOROX_SEAL=seal_c78f63c1
JOROX_STANDBY_TEAM=norax

During the Marlowe Wing renovation, all Ferncastle staff operate from the temporary site at Dunhollow Yard. The facilities desk there opens at 07:00; after hours, entry is via the side gate only. Deliveries should be logged in the yard book before unloading. The side gate keypad accepts the code below.

turnstile pass: bdg-TXR-4